Organizers of the Northern Marianas Sports Challenge has scheduled a 5 km fun run on July 10th as part of the activities for the 10-day sport event.

The 5 km challenge run will be conducted by the Northern Marianas Track and Field Federation beginning 6:30 AM in Susupe along Beach Road. The race starts and ends at Kilili Beach Park.

Sports memorabilia will be given to each runner who completes the race, as well as special awards to top finishers.

The Challenge Fitness Walk will also take place led by First Lady Sophie Tenorio, guest athletes and government officials. Everyone is invited to participate. Special awards will be given to the youngest and oldest participant.

The walk will be held along Beach Road from the Tank at the Quartermaster Road, finishing at the Kilili Beach Park. The first 100 participants will receive T-shirts.

Pre-registration is recommended and forms are available at the Gilbert C. Ada Gym. Entry fee is $1.00 for Northern Marianas Sports Challenge card holders and $5.00 for non-members.

Organizers are hoping to attract over 300 participants to this fitness event.

Other activities have been lined up for the 10-day event, which begins on July 8.

Sports celebrities from the United States and Japan will participate in the Sports Challenge, an event which organizers hoped would encourage youths to engage in sports and stay away from drugs.

Clinics, golf tournament, discussion with sports personalities and family activities with guest athletes will also be held on Saipan, Rota and Tinian.
